What Is a Hookah and How Does It Work?

A hookah is a water pipe used for smoking flavored tobacco. The tobacco is placed in the bowl at the top of the hookah, and hot coals are used to heat the tobacco. The smoke passes through the water in the base of the hookah before being inhaled through the hose.

Many types of hookahs are available on the market, from traditional to modern designs. While the basic function of a hookah remains, the same, different hookahs can offer different smoking experiences.

The Different Types of Hookahs

There are two main types of hookahs: traditional and modern.

Traditional Hookah

Traditional hookahs are typically brass or copper, with intricate designs and detailed ornamentation. These hookahs often have multiple hookah hoses and can be used for communal smoking.

Modern Hookah

More functional yet still stylish, modern hookahs are typically made of stainless steel or aluminum. These hookahs often have single or double hoses; some even come with built-in diffusers for a smooth smoking experience.

How To Choose The Right Hookah for You?

Now that you know the different types of hookahs available, it's time to choose the right one for you. Here are a few things to keep in mind when making your decision:

Hookah Weight

If you plan on smoking at home, weight and portability won't be as big of a factor in your decision. However, if you're taking your hookah with you on the go, you'll want to choose a lighter, easy transport option.

Hookah Height

The height of your hookah will determine how much smoke is produced with each inhale. Taller hookahs produce more smoke, while shorter hookahs are better for flavor.

Number of Hose Ports (Hookah Hose Options)

Choose a hookah with multiple hose ports if you plan on smoking with friends. This way, everyone can enjoy the smoking experience without sharing a single hose.

Country of Manufacturing (Hookah Brands)

Many different hookah brands are available on the market, each with its own manufacturing process and smoke quality control standards. If you're looking for a high-quality hookah, choose a brand known for its craftsmanship and attention to detail.

Most of the hookah brands we carry are made in Russia, Germany, Ukraine, China, and the USA. Of all of them, Russia is the most experienced country, with a history dating back to the 16th century.

Diffuser

If you want a smooth smoking experience, look for a hookah with a hookah diffuser. A diffuser helps to cool the smoke and filter out impurities, giving you a smoother hit with each puff.

Hookah Price Range

Hookahs range in price from $30 to $3,000, so there's sure to be an option that fits your budget. Keep in mind that the price of a hookah doesn't necessarily reflect its quality—many of the less expensive hookahs on the market smoke just as well as their higher-priced counterparts.

Tips for Better Smoking Experience

If you're new to hookah smoking, here are a few tips to help you get the most out of your experience:

Use the Appropriate Amount of Tobacco

One of the most common mistakes new hookah smokers make is using too much tobacco. When packing your hookah bowl, use only enough tobacco to cover the holes at the bottom of the bowl. Using too much tobacco will make it difficult to draw smoke through the hose and can result in a harsh smoking experience.

Don't Overheat Your Coals

If your hookah coals are too hot, the tobacco will burn instead of smoke. This will produce a harsh, unpleasant flavor. To avoid this, be sure to allow your coals to ash over before placing them in your bowl.

Switch to Natural Coals

If you're using quick-light coals, we recommend switching to natural coals. Quick-light coals are made of compressed charcoal infused with chemicals and accelerants. These chemicals can give your tobacco an unpleasant flavor. Natural coals are made of pure charcoal and light without using chemicals.

Keep It Clean

Be sure to clean your hookah after each use. This will help remove any built-up residue and prevent mold or mildew formation. Simply disassemble the parts and rinse them with warm water to clean your hookah.

Don't Forget to Blow Air Out

After taking a draw, be sure to blow the smoke out before taking another puff. This will help prevent the tobacco from burning and make it easier to draw smoke through the hose.
